The Undergraduate Certificate in Value Added Tax (VAT) in the UK is a specialized program designed to equip learners with in-depth knowledge of VAT regulations, compliance, and practical applications. This course is ideal for those seeking to enhance their expertise in tax-related fields or advance their careers in finance, accounting, or business advisory roles.
Key learning outcomes include mastering VAT principles, understanding UK and EU VAT legislation, and developing skills to manage VAT returns and audits effectively. Participants will also gain insights into digital tax systems, such as Making Tax Digital (MTD), ensuring they stay aligned with industry standards and technological advancements.
